Abstract: |
Three trial trenches excavated in advance of the proposed construction of two dwellings across land within the medieval village recorded evidence for medieval occupation. Occupation probably started in the 12th century and included the stone footings of a building close to and aligned on the road together with a number of ditches and gullies set at right angles to it. Occupation ceased in the 14th century and did not recommence until the 17th/18th century when a yard surface was lain down, a boundary ditch cut and a small structure or a fenceline was erected. In the 19th century the area next to the road was given over to horticulture and post holes for a fenceline and a ditch from this period were excavated. The foundations and lower walling of a brick shed or greenhouse of probable 20th century date were also recorded. Two worked prehistoric flints and a single residual sherd of Romano-British pottery were recovered from the topsoil. [Au(abr)] |
